Not all the same at all. Different geometries for each one. Some can keep stock A-arms. Some require tubular ones. Some move wheels out, forward, back, etc. Some allow moving motor back towards center of car.

Do some research on all of the major companies' products: Steeda, QA1, Griggs, Maximum Motorsports, Dugan Racing, etc...

AJE, MM, Kenny Brown, and Griggs are the best.
AJE, is really the only affordable one of the bunch, and it allows you to use stock control arms and springs, if you purchase the spring perches.

Expect to drop a G to get the rest of them in the car and running.

The rest may get bent up during Daily Driving usage.

Definetely no matter what you do, avoid UPR, it will NOT put up with street use.
